What brand is MAXWAY tire?

MAXWAY tires are produced by Giti Tire. The size is 215/70R15C. MAXWAY is a tire brand under Giti Tire. Giti Tire, originally founded in Singapore, entered the Chinese market in 1993 and has established sales subsidiaries or offices in the United States, Canada, Germany, the United Kingdom, France, Indonesia, and Brazil. It is one of the world's leading tire manufacturers. When using MAXWAY tires in daily life, pay attention to the following points: Regularly check the tire surface for cracks, deformations, or other defects. Due to wear from driving, the tread grooves of the tire gradually become shallow. If the tread is worn flat, it will lose its drainage and anti-skid functions, significantly reducing the vehicle's performance. Small cracks may also pose a risk of tire blowouts at high speeds. Additionally, promptly remove pebbles lodged in the grooves. Try to park on flat ground. Avoid parking on roads with thick, sharp, or pointed stones. Do not park the vehicle near or in contact with petroleum products, acids, or other materials that may cause rubber deterioration. After parking, the driver should avoid turning the steering wheel, as this can accelerate tire wear. Do not splash water to cool the tires. In hot weather or during high-speed driving, tires are prone to overheating, and the air pressure may increase. In such cases, park to allow the tires to cool naturally. Never release air to reduce pressure or splash water to cool the tires, as this can cause abnormal aging of the tread rubber. Avoid sudden braking. Try to minimize frequent use of brakes and sudden braking to prevent accelerated tread wear caused by dragging between the tires and the ground.

Is Transmission Fluid Universal?

Transmission fluid is not universal. Users should refer to the manual for the correct type of transmission fluid to use. Mixing different types of transmission fluid can have serious consequences, as each type of transmission has its own specific fluid. It is essential to use the appropriate fluid for the specific transmission type. For example, CVT transmission fluid is similar in nature to AT fluid. A transmission is a mechanism used to alter the speed and torque from the engine, capable of fixed or stepped changes in the output-to-input shaft ratio, also known as a gearbox. The transmission consists of a gear mechanism and a control mechanism, and some vehicles also include a power take-off mechanism. Most gear mechanisms use standard gear transmissions, while some employ planetary gear systems. Standard gear transmission mechanisms typically use sliding gears and synchronizers.

What are the dimensions of the Mercedes-Benz S400?

The length is 5246mm, the width is 1899mm, and the height is 1498mm. Exterior Design: The front part follows the family style changes of recent years, featuring a larger and more sharply contoured lower edge of the radiator grille. The rear part removes the body-colored trim on the taillight assembly, replacing it with a full LED light group, combined with the design of the reverse light assembly. This retains the original style of the two decorative strips while providing better lighting effects at the rear.
